Perth County recognized nationally for emergency preparedness system

Perth County and its member municipalities are being recognized nationally for their emergency preparedness system.

The Perth County Emergency Services Municipal 511 Project was selected by a judging panel from the Canadian Tri-Services Emergency Management Committee to receive the 2018 CACP Motorola Solutions Award for “Excellence in Emergency Preparedness.”

Perth County was selected by the panel from nominations across the country.

The national award from the Canadian Association of Chiefs of Police and Motorola Solutions was established to recognize a standard level of excellence that exemplifies the combined efforts of police, fire and paramedic services in preparing their agencies for responding to natural or human-caused disasters.
